摘要

在过去二十年里,美国的专利诉讼急剧增加,这主要是由专利巨头驱动的。通过利用 34 个州交错采用反巨头法这一可信的外生冲击来降低这些巨头的专利诉讼风险,我们发现企业在反巨头法颁布后会显著增加其叙述性 R&D 披露。在面临较大竞争压力的企业中,这种效应并不明显,而在更容易受到专利巨魔威胁的企业中,这种效应则更为明显。进一步的分析减轻了人们的担忧,即反巨魔法对信息披露的影响可归因于国家层面的经济或政策变化。我们的研究结果凸显了专利流氓诉讼在影响研发信息传播方面的重要作用。

Patent litigation and narrative R&D disclosures: Evidence from the adoption of anti-troll legislation
The last two decades have witnessed a sharp increase in patent litigation in the United States (U.S.), mainly driven by patent trolls. By exploiting the staggered adoption of Anti-Troll laws across 34 states as a plausible exogenous shock that reduces the risk of patent litigation by these trolls, we show that firms significantly increase their narrative R&D disclosures following the enactment of Anti-Troll laws. This effect is less pronounced in firms facing higher competitive pressure, and more pronounced in firms that are more exposed to threats from patent trolls. Further analyses alleviate the concern that the impact of Anti-Troll laws on disclosures is attributable to state-level economic or policy changes. Our results highlight the significant role of patent troll litigation in influencing the dissemination of narrative R&D information.
